The MSBA is offered as a 1-year program on campus in Amherst or Newton. Both on-campus options have achieved classification as a STEM (science, technology, engineering, and math) program.

Specialized, 1-Year Training

The MS in Business Analytics delivers the specialized business analytics expertise needed to succeed in any organization. MSBA students choose between two tracksBusiness Foundations or Data Analytics—depending on career goals and prior business experience. Students can choose to further deepen their knowledge of data analytics by undertaking the optional concentration in Advanced Analytics. Newton

UMass Amherst’s Mount Ida Campus in Newton offers students an intimate campus experience just 10 miles outside of downtown Boston. In addition to all the services UMass Amherst offers—including an onsite fitness center, award-winning dining services and the Chase Career Center—there is also the option to apply for on-campus housing. Free parking and free transportation to the MBTA green line provide easy access to Boston.

The proximity to Boston companies in such industries as life sciences, sports tech and business consulting makes professional development opportunities through the Isenberg network and internships easily accessible. If you start your degree online in the summer, you can choose to join a cohort and study on campus in the fall.

4+1 Master's Degrees

4+1 Master's Degrees

Undergraduate students at UMass Amherst and other colleges in the Five College Consortium can pursue a 4+1 option, completing their undergraduate degree and their master's degree in 5 years. 

The 4+1 option can also be accelerated, allowing students to complete both their undergraduate and master's degrees in fewer than 5 years. Isenberg's Master of Finance, Master of Science in Accounting, and Master of Science in Business Analytics all offer this accelerated option.

Interested students should apply to a master's degree program in their junior year or early in their senior year.
